实验室菌落计数精密度控制研究-Ⅱ方法研究 被引量:1

Study of accuracy of aerobic colony counting in laboratory-Ⅱ methodology

摘要 为使室间及室内检测数据的准确度及精密度控制控制在一定的范围,保证相关的卫生微生物实验室出具准确的检测数据,选用明胶菌片作为菌落计数室间及室内质控比对品。随机抽取明胶菌片和滤纸菌片各10片进行计数检测;取同一批号的明胶菌片发放给不同实验室进行室间比对;明胶菌片分别经1个月、3个月及6个月保存后进行稳定性计数测定。结果显示同一批次明胶菌片和滤纸菌片的相对标准偏差(RSD)分别为11%和223%,表明明胶菌片的精密度高于滤纸菌片;75个实验室室间明胶菌片计数结果95%的可信区间为551×107~803×107CFU片,有9683%的单位在此范围中;明胶菌片4℃冰箱保存1、3、6个月的检测结果的均数误差差异无显著性。采用明胶菌片作为菌落计数质控比对品,在精密度、准确度及可操作性方面都能达到相应的要求。 To control the accuracy of examination data in certain scope and ensure the related hygienic microbiological laboratory issues the accurate data, gelatin piece of bacteria was adopted as the contrast for quality control. The colony count of such gelatin pieces and filter paper pieces selected randomly were tested and their mean values of relative standard deviation ( RSD ) indicated that gelatin piece of bacteria provided more accurate result than the latter. Meanwhile, such wafers in one room and in different rooms and kept for different days were counted respectively, the results revealed that there were no remarkable difference among them. The results show that the gelatin piece of bacteria is appropriate for colony counting as contrast.
